hadoop部署单机

将jjdk-6u45-linux-x64.bin与hadoop-2.5.2.tar.gz放在目录/home/dongwengao/hadoop中

vi /etc/hosts

#./jdk-6u45-linux-x64.bin解压

# tar -zxvf hadoop-2.5.2.tar.gz解压

进入解压后的hadoop-2.5.2中,修改hadoop-2.5.2中的 etc/hadoop中的配置文件

修改配置文件

 

修改hadoop-env.sh配置jdk的bin

 

 修改mapred-site.xml添加

 

 修改core-site.xml

修改hdfs-site.xml

修改yarn-site.xml 添加

修改slaves也可不修改,默认里有一个localhost

 

启动hadoop:

不提倡:

sbin/start-all.sh

一步一步:

格式化 # bin/hadoop namenode -format

启动namenode sbin/hadoop-daemon.sh start namenode

调用 #/jdk1.6.0_45/bin/jps发现多了一个线程NameNode表示启动成功

可以通过/home/dongwengao/hadoop/hadoop-2.5.2/hadoop-root-namenode-node1.log查看日志

启动datanode

sbin/hadoop-daemon.sh start datanode

 

启动yarn

# sbin/yarn-daemon.sh

打开浏览器输入:yarn001:8088

运行案例:

#bin/hadoop jar share/hadoop/mapreduce/hadoop-mapreduce.example-*.*.* jar pi 2 100

关:

#sbin/stop-yarn.sh

#sbin/stop-dfs.sh

 

posted @ 2018-07-07 10:23  hotMemo  阅读(187)  评论(0编辑  收藏  举报